Ebola: Current Outbreak and Health Implications

Introduction to Ebola
Ebola, a viral hemorrhagic fever, is one of the most deadly diseases known to humanity. First identified in 1976, the Ebola virus can cause severe symptoms and has a high mortality rate. Recent outbreaks in regions such as the Democratic Republic of the Congo (DRC) have heightened the global focus on the disease, underscoring the importance of surveillance, preventive measures, and public health responses.

Global Health Impact
The Ebola outbreaks not only pose a direct threat to health but also have significant socio-economic impacts. In affected regions, fear and misinformation can lead to reduced healthcare access and increased stigma towards survivors. The international community, therefore, must bolster support for health systems in these areas, provide technical assistance, and contribute to research on vaccines and treatments.
Recent developments in vaccine technology, including the rVSV-ZEBOV vaccine, have shown promising results in offering immunity against the Ebola virus, proving essential in outbreak response strategies. Nonetheless, ongoing commitment to vaccine deployment, healthcare infrastructure, and education is vital in mitigating future outbreaks.
